Maritime Alert - October 2024

Resolution of the National Superintendence of Public Registries No. 0014-2023-SUNARP/SN was published, which approves the publication of the draft that modifies the Regulations for the Registration of Vessels, Fishery Vessels and Ships (hereinafter, “the Registration Regulations”).
The purpose of the resolution is to adapt and simplify the requirements and procedures for the registration of acts and rights related to vessels, in accordance with the provisions of Legislative Decree No. 1400 and its regulations.
The draft regulation amends the “Regulations on Registration of Ships, Fishery Vessels and Ships”, changing its name to “Regulations on Registration of Ships and Vessels” and updating several articles to clarify registration requirements and processes. A new Chapter IV is added establishing guidelines for the registration and cancellation of charges and encumbrances, including specific requirements and expiration terms. It details the conditions for the annotation of liens and precautionary measures, as well as provisions on the renewal and cancellation of these registrations.
The public has until October 12 to make comments or contributions, which should be sent to https://mesadetramite.sunarp.gob.pe/, or to the following e-mail addresses: eyanac@sunarp.gob.pe and sdiaz@sunarp.gob.pe.
